In Memory of William “Bill G” Gegenheimer

A photo of a man smiling and dressed in a fine white dress shirt with a blue tie and a pen in his front left pocket.

Last week, Riester lost a dear friend and its founding CFO, William Gegenheimer.  Affectionately referred to by all who worked at Riester as “Bill G,” Bill helped his stepson, Tim Riester, found the company and assisted in its responsible growth as its CFO for nearly 20 years.

Bill G mentored staff, befriended clients, and was legendary for his organization, discipline, and his absolute refusal to spend money unnecessarily. Bill’s courage and humor were matched by resourcefulness: when a mugger held him at gunpoint outside the Riester office buildings and demanded his wallet, Bill famously screamed “HELL NO!” and scared off the would-be robber.

Bill G’s life was one of intelligence, adventure, courage, and commitment. His dependability, laughter, and stories will live forever in the hearts of those who loved him.
